> Is it okay practice to condtionally include php files that contain only > classes or functions (as opposed to just straight code)? The result > is a class or function inserted right in the middle of an if{} block: It is better to do so, since you don't waste the processor's time with the function/class or include() process if you don't really need it. However, it can be tricky making sure that these libraries are available to your code, since there is now a condition determining whether or not it will be processed.
